Dr Sknn deploy the Lynton Lumina, a cutting-edge Intense Pulsed Light System (IPL), also employed by the National Health Service and private hospitals across Britain, to treat Campbell De Morgan Spots in a secure and efficient way on skin types I-IV. Through sending out light in exact wavelength ranges, we target absorption peaks in haemoglobin and oxy-haemoglobin enabling us to treat Campbell De Morgan Spots of diverse sizes and depths with minimal damage to the nearby skin. Afterwards, the ruined vessels are absorbed by the body and the initial lesion is rarely visible.

Why Choose Dr Sknn for Campbell De Morgan Spots
At Dr Sknn, during the appointment a medical history and physical examination including photographs will be taken. There is a chance to talk about any apprehensions, objectives, results or enquiries you may have. Prior to the procedure, any post-treatment advice and any risks connected to the Intense Pulsed Light (IPL) will be outlined and a consent form will be signed. Furthermore, a small patch test will be done if it is a new area being treated to check the suitability.
